University of Science and Technology – The University of Danang signed a cooperation agreement with 6 other Vietnam’s leading technical universities in high-tech fields

04/11/2024

On 5th October, 2024, leader representatives of University of Science and Technology – the University of Danang (DUT-UD) and 6 leading technical universities in Vietnam (Hanoi University of Science and Technology, University of Technology – Vietnam National University in HCMC, Hanoi University of Civil Engineering, University of Transport and Communication, University of Mining and Geology, and University of Water Resource) sign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MOU) on training and scientific research in high-tech fields.

According to the signed MOU, the universities will cooperate in sectors and fields such as: Information Technology, Manufacturing Technology, Telecommunications Electronics, Automation Control and sectors serving green growth such as: New materials, semiconductor materials, urban railways, high-speed railways,... especially microelectronics and microchip design; build a digital transformation infrastructure network to exchange information on learning materials and digital resources; share experience in university governance and autonomy towards digital universities, smart universities,...

According to Assoc. Prof. Dr. Nguyen Thu Thuy, Director of the Department of Higher Education – Ministry of Education and Training, the ministry is seeking comments on the Draft Project on Training Human Resources for High-tech Development in the 2025 – 2035 period and orientation to 2045. The signing of leading universities in the fields of engineering and technology, in which University of Science and Technology – UD plays a core role, has a breakthrough meaning, creating a premise for cooperation in training high-quality human resources to meet the development and integration needs of the country.

Since 2020, the group of 7 technical universities has signed and implemented 9 MOUs with quite comprehensive contents, suitable to the potential and strengths of each university in the areas of enrollment, training program development, university governance, digital transformation, scientific research and application, technology transfer to serve businesses and the community,...

Previously, on October 4, 2024, the group of 7 technical universities, including the University of Science and Technology – UD, also signed a cooperation agreement with the People’s Committee of Nghe An province to promote training activities, improve the quality of human resource, training at undergraduate and postgraduate levels in engineering and technology for the locality.
